  • Spring and autumn provide the most comfortable weather for sightseeing.
  • Reserve Cappadocia balloon rides in advance, especially during peak travel months.
  • Wear supportive walking shoes for archaeological sites and uneven stone pathways.
  • Visit Pamukkale and Cappadocia early for softer light and fewer crowds.
  • Carry sun protection and water during outdoor excursions, particularly in summer.

Visa and entry requirements for Turkey vary depending on your nationality. Before traveling, we recommend that all guests check the latest visa regulations and passport validity requirements applicable to their country of residence. Turkey offers visa-free entry for many nationalities, while others may apply for an electronic visa (e-Visa) online or obtain a visa through Turkish diplomatic missions. Your passport should generally be valid for at least six months beyond your arrival date and contain sufficient blank pages for entry and exit stamps.
